The UK launches a 2026 Deposit Return Scheme mandating retailers to accept and refund single-use drink containers.
In 2026, the UK launches a Deposit Return Scheme requiring major retailers like Tesco, Asda, and Morrisons to accept returned single-use drink containers made of aluminium, steel, or PET plastic, between 150ml and 3 litres, for a refund.
Consumers will receive money back when returning empty bottles and cans to designated return points, either manual or automated.
The program, managed by Defra, aims to reduce litter and environmental harm, with all producers, importers, wholesalers, and retailers required to comply.
